How Lever parses & screens your resume

Lever is a modern, candidate-friendly ATS in the same family as Greenhouse. It parses PDFs and links cleanly and is built around recruiter sourcing and human review rather than a hidden keyword auto-reject.

Like Greenhouse, Lever does not silently keyword-reject you. Recruiters search and source candidates by skills and titles, and hiring teams evaluate you through structured feedback. Being findable in search and showing clear impact are what move you forward.

The verdict on Lever

Candidate-friendly, like Greenhouse. Be findable in sourcing and convincing to the human who reads it.

Why resumes get rejected by Lever

The four mistakes that most often sink an application before a recruiter ever sees it.

Not findable in sourcing

Lever recruiters actively source by keyword. Missing the core skills and exact title from the posting keeps you out of their search results.

Duties instead of outcomes

Human reviewers reward measurable impact. Replace "responsible for" bullets with quantified results.

No links for link-friendly roles

Lever parses portfolio and GitHub links well and reviewers use them — omit them and you drop a strong signal for technical and design roles.

Untailored applications

Because a person reads it, a resume that visibly mirrors the role's priorities outperforms a generic one.

Lever resume formatting rules

  • Single-column is safest; clean two-column layouts usually parse acceptably.
  • PDF preserves formatting for the human reviewer.
  • Quantify every achievement bullet.
  • Include working portfolio / GitHub / LinkedIn links.
  • Mirror the role title and top skills so recruiters source you.

Keyword tip for Lever

Lever is human-first — include the role's keywords so you surface in sourcing, then let quantified, tailored bullets win the review.

Does Lever auto-reject on keywords?
No. Lever is built for recruiter sourcing and human review, not silent keyword rejection. Focus on being findable in search and showing measurable impact.
Is a designed, two-column resume safe for Lever?
Usually yes — Lever handles clean layouts well. If you also apply through legacy systems like Taleo, keep a single-column version too.
What wins a Lever review?
Quantified achievements, a resume tailored to the role's priorities, and working portfolio or GitHub links the reviewer can open.
